Researchers looked at breast cancer in young women over 20 years and found that rates increased more than 0.5% per year in 21 states, while remaining stable or decreasing in other states.
A paper in the Journal of Breast Imaging indicates that breast cancer mortality rates have stopped declining in women older than age 74, and reconfirms that breast cancer mortality rates have stopped falling in women younger than age 40.
More than 120 million Americans suffer from diabetes or pre-diabetes. Triple-negative breast cancer (TNBC) is the most aggressive form of breast cancer, and TNBC patients with obesity-driven diabetes often have worse outcomes.

Breast cancer is the most common cancer diagnosed in women globally. But, in part thanks to screening programs, over 75% of those diagnosed with breast cancer in England now survive for 10 years or more.

A lumpectomy plus radiation is very effective for treating stage zero cancer, but new research suggests that active monitoring may be just as good.
A global study finds that breast cancer cases will rise by 38% and deaths by 68% by 2050, with the highest incidence in Australia and New Zealand and worsening mortality in low-income countries.
